Human Resources Manager Marshall, TX
Prysmian is the world leader in the energy and telecom cable systems industry. Each year, the company manufactures thousands of miles of underground and submarine cables and systems for power transmission and distribution, as well as medium low voltage cables for the construction and infrastructure sectors. We also produce a comprehensive range of optical fibers, copper cables and connectivity for voice, video and data transmission for the telecommunication sector.
We are 30,000 employees across 50+ countries. Everyone at Prysmian has the potential to make their mark; because whatever you do, wherever you are based, you will be part of a company that is helping transform the world around us.
Overview
Reporting to the Regional Human Resource Business Partner, the Human Resources Manager is a strategic, hands-on leader responsible for all HR functions at our Marshall, TX manufacturing facility. This role is instrumental in cultivating a high-performance culture, fostering strong labor relations, and serving as a trusted advisor to plant leadership and staff.
A key focus of this role is leading labor relations in a unionized environment . The HR Manager will serve as the primary liaison with union leadership , ensuring compliance, collaboration, and effective resolution of labor issues. This individual must be a confident communicator and voice of reason , capable of influencing decisions, guiding leadership through complex employee matters, and maintaining a positive and productive workplace culture.
The HR Manager is accountable for the effective implementation of HR best practices , including employee relations, regulatory compliance, performance management, talent acquisition and development, succession planning, internal communications, policy administration, payroll, compensation, and benefits. They are also the go-to resource for senior leadership , frequently called upon at a moment's notice to deliver clear, accurate, and balanced insights that support critical business decisions. This includes the ability to craft and present compelling narratives using data and context to influence outcomes and drive alignment.
The ideal candidate is comfortable navigating shifting priorities in a dynamic manufacturing environment while maintaining focus on long-term strategic goals. They will be a driver of team development and organizational growth , elevating HR capabilities and fostering a culture of continuous improvement, accountability, and engagement across all levels of the plant.
